L’Vov vs Saint Peter, Mn Climate & Distance Between

Usa flag
  • The distance between L’Vov, Ukraine and Saint Peter, Mn, Usa is approximately 7,978 km or 4,958 mi.
  • To reach L’Vov in this distance one would set out from Saint Peter, Mn bearing 36.9°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ach L’Vov bearing 138° or SE .
  • L’Vov has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Saint Peter, Mn has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
  • L’Vov is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Saint Peter, Mn is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ome.
  • The average annual temperature is 0.7 °C (1.3°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.4 °C (20.5°F) less in L’Vov.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ly continental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 5.6 mm (0.2 in) more which is equivalent to 5.6 l/m² (0.14 US gal/ft²) or 56,000 l/ha (5,987 US gal/ac) more. About 1 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 5.8° lower in L’Vov than in Saint Peter, Mn.
